I am trying to add dependency of a plugin into my grails application, but it doesnot have any plugins in grails repo. It can be added to maven project as :
<dependency>
<groupId>com.plaid</groupId>
<artifactId>plaid-java</artifactId>
<version>0.2.12</version>
</dependency>
As my project is also maven based. How do i add this plugin into my project.
P.S. : IT cannot be added in plugins and dependencies since there is no grails plugin associated with that.
Any help is appreciated.

We can add dependency for any plugin in grails under dependencies{}
in BuildConfig.groovy as:
<groupId>:<artifactId>[:<extension>[:<classifier>]]:<version>
For your case, the equivalent for:
<dependency>
<groupId>com.plaid</groupId>
<artifactId>plaid-java</artifactId>
<version>0.2.12</version>
</dependency>
is:
dependencies{
compile "com.plaid:plaid-java:0.2.12"
}
For more you can have a look into http://docs.grails.org/2.3.1/guide/conf.html

You can use the create-pom org.mycompany
to create your pom.xml file to make grails read the pom.xml you need to set in BuildConfig.groovy this code
grails.project.dependency.resolution = {
/*YOUR CONFIG*/
pom true
repositories {
/*YOUR RESPOSITORIES*/
}
}
Then you need to add your dependency in this pom.xml
